28. Since this year, the Company has always emphasized the execution. At the same time, it has also conducted various education and training on how to strengthen the execution, and has also improved the execution through performance appraisal. These measures have also played a role in improving the execution to a certain extent, but the overall feeling effect is not obviously effective. Our company's execution does not have practical supervision and follow-up measures in the middle of the execution, and many problems are easy to end up in anticlimactic situations. For example, what is determined at each middle-level regular meeting is transmitted to the middle-level. So, how is it implemented in the middle after the meeting? Do you need supervision and follow-up? How? Will supervision become a mere formality? How to feedback after the problem is implemented? Is the feedback true? Such issues need to be considered.

DDOS attacks mainly occur in the network layer. Its most obvious characteristic is to send a large number of attack packets, consume network bandwidth resources and affect normal users' access. At present, the detection and defense technology for DDOS attacks in the network layer is quite mature, and at the same time, some new attack methods-DDOS attacks in the application layer have emerged. Different from network layer DDOS attacks, application layer DDOS attacks mostly imitate the access behavior of legitimate users and will not generate a large number of attack data packets during data transmission, but they will consume server resources through a large number of database queries and other operations, which is more difficult to detect. According to the different attack modes, DDOS attacks include reflection amplification attacks in addition to ordinary flooding attacks. This type of attack often uses a legitimate server as a reflector, which sends a large number of data packets to the target, thus causing greater harm. At present, DDOS attacks against DNS servers are also common. Attackers often send fake domain names to DNS servers, consuming DNS server resources. At the same time, due to the recursive query mechanism in DNS servers, DDOS attacks against DNS servers have a large impact range.
